Choosing the Right Grill for Fire and Spice
I usually start by deciding between charcoal, gas, pellet, or a combination grill. If I want bold smoky flavor, I lean toward charcoal or pellet grills. If I want quick heat and easy control, I prefer gas. For a fire-and-spice style BBQ, I like a grill that can reach high temperatures for searing while also holding low heat for slow cooking. That flexibility helps me cook spicy ribs, seasoned chicken, and fire-roasted vegetables with better results.
Why Heat Control Matters to Me
In my experience, heat control is one of the most important features in any BBQ purchase. Spicy rubs and marinades can burn quickly if the fire is too strong, so I look for adjustable vents, multiple burners, or temperature settings. Good heat control lets me cook with confidence and keeps my food flavorful instead of charred in the wrong way.

Fuel Type and Flavor Preference
My choice of fuel depends on the flavor I want. Charcoal gives me that classic smoky taste I love for spicy barbecue. Wood pellets add a richer aroma and are great for slow-cooked meats. Gas is my pick when I want speed and convenience. Sometimes I even use wood chips or spice-infused marinades to layer extra flavor onto the fire.

Easy Cleaning and Maintenance
I always choose a BBQ that is easy to clean because maintenance affects how often I enjoy using it. Removable grates, grease trays, and simple ash collection systems save me time. When cleanup is easy, I am more likely to use the grill regularly and keep it in good shape.
